106b1066bb3f: Bug 1447052 - Set up LightweightThemeConsumer in onDOMContentLoaded instead of onLoad. r=dao, a=jcristau DEVEDITION_60_0b8_BUILD1 DEVEDITION_60_0b8_RELEASE FIREFOX_60_0b8_BUILD1 FIREFOX_60_0b8_RELEASE
Brian Grinstead <bgrinstead@mozilla.com> - Wed, 28 Mar 2018 17:19:00 -0400 - rev 460442
Push 8944 by ryanvm@gmail.com at Thu, 29 Mar 2018 15:41:19 +0000
Bug 1447052 - Set up LightweightThemeConsumer in onDOMContentLoaded instead of onLoad. r=dao, a=jcristau This is specifically for Fx60 uplift, since the patch landed for Fx61 used onBeforeInitialXULLayout which isn't available on earlier releases.
da6d3b5f248b: Bug 1448612 - Mark ContinueConsumeBodyControlRunnable as explicit to make the static analysis happy. r=emilio, a=bustage
Ryan VanderMeulen <ryanvm@gmail.com> - Thu, 29 Mar 2018 10:46:07 -0400 - rev 460441
Push 8944 by ryanvm@gmail.com at Thu, 29 Mar 2018 15:41:19 +0000
Bug 1448612 - Mark ContinueConsumeBodyControlRunnable as explicit to make the static analysis happy. r=emilio, a=bustage
2bb8a74aa36c: Bug 1447969 - r=nchevobbe,a=abillings
Gijs Kruitbosch <gijskruitbosch@gmail.com> - Wed, 28 Mar 2018 14:57:09 +0100 - rev 460440
Push 8943 by gijskruitbosch@gmail.com at Thu, 29 Mar 2018 15:39:41 +0000
Bug 1447969 - r=nchevobbe,a=abillings
75cefda36f28: Bug 1448771 - Merge fix from upstream. r=ryanvm, a=RyanVM
Jonathan Kew <jkew@mozilla.com> - Mon, 26 Mar 2018 20:35:48 +0100 - rev 460439
Push 8942 by ryanvm@gmail.com at Thu, 29 Mar 2018 14:09:55 +0000
Bug 1448771 - Merge fix from upstream. r=ryanvm, a=RyanVM
2f2e601e1394: Bug 1448771 - Update hnjstdio to handle additional functions from stdio.h that libhyphen wants to use. r=glandium, a=RyanVM
Jonathan Kew <jkew@mozilla.com> - Wed, 28 Mar 2018 10:17:51 +0100 - rev 460438
Push 8942 by ryanvm@gmail.com at Thu, 29 Mar 2018 14:09:55 +0000
Bug 1448771 - Update hnjstdio to handle additional functions from stdio.h that libhyphen wants to use. r=glandium, a=RyanVM
294c100c1a17: Bug 1449018 - The bookmark panel should listen to keypress event at the system event group. r=mak, a=jcristau
Masayuki Nakano <masayuki@d-toybox.com> - Tue, 27 Mar 2018 16:50:18 +0900 - rev 460437
Push 8942 by ryanvm@gmail.com at Thu, 29 Mar 2018 14:09:55 +0000
Bug 1449018 - The bookmark panel should listen to keypress event at the system event group. r=mak, a=jcristau The bookmark panel should handle keypress events at the system event group because it needs to handle keypress events after autocomplete module which handles keypress events at the system event group. MozReview-Commit-ID: 9KjBlQ59gHw
45de343ccebd: Bug 1448085 - Fix the enterprise policy to set homepage to use the correct mechanism for setting complex prefs. r=Felipe, a=jcristau
Kirk Steuber <ksteuber@mozilla.com> - Thu, 22 Mar 2018 15:18:43 -0700 - rev 460436
Push 8942 by ryanvm@gmail.com at Thu, 29 Mar 2018 14:09:55 +0000
Bug 1448085 - Fix the enterprise policy to set homepage to use the correct mechanism for setting complex prefs. r=Felipe, a=jcristau MozReview-Commit-ID: 4rGa9TWSEgw
901288518dfd: Bug 1448612 - Don't take ownership of the stream data too early. r=baku, a=RyanVM
Emilio Cobos Álvarez <emilio@crisal.io> - Thu, 29 Mar 2018 10:02:00 -0400 - rev 460435
Push 8942 by ryanvm@gmail.com at Thu, 29 Mar 2018 14:09:55 +0000
Bug 1448612 - Don't take ownership of the stream data too early. r=baku, a=RyanVM MozReview-Commit-ID: 8e8PNR9NvwW
a9b81a287bd3: Bug 1444537 - Part 2: Shutting down the decode pool should make animated decoders bail early. r=tnikkel, a=jcristau
Andrew Osmond <aosmond@mozilla.com> - Tue, 27 Mar 2018 10:57:01 -0400 - rev 460434
Push 8942 by ryanvm@gmail.com at Thu, 29 Mar 2018 14:09:55 +0000
Bug 1444537 - Part 2: Shutting down the decode pool should make animated decoders bail early. r=tnikkel, a=jcristau When we shutdown the decode pool threads, it does not do a simple join with the main thread. It will actually process the main thread event loop, which can cause a bad series of events. The refresh tick could still be running and advancing our animated images, causing the animated decoders to continue running, which in turn prevents the decoder threads from finishing shutting down, and the main thread from joining them. Now we check on each frame whether or not the decoder should just stop decoding more frames because the decode pool has started shutdown. If it has, it will stop immediately.
9c6d282fa4b4: Bug 1444537 - Part 1: Ensure discarding of animated image frames is clear. r=tnikkel, a=jcristau
Andrew Osmond <aosmond@mozilla.com> - Tue, 27 Mar 2018 10:56:48 -0400 - rev 460433
Push 8942 by ryanvm@gmail.com at Thu, 29 Mar 2018 14:09:55 +0000
Bug 1444537 - Part 1: Ensure discarding of animated image frames is clear. r=tnikkel, a=jcristau We should only attempt to discard animation image frames after passing the frame threshold on the very first pass on the animation. Redecodes are already in the correct state, as it will discard frames as it advances the animation. This patch makes it clear what it should be doing when, but there should be no functional change.
8f10c0a7a87f: Bug 1447796 - Fix closing page action panels using commands. r=rpl, a=jcristau
Shane Caraveo <scaraveo@mozilla.com> - Tue, 27 Mar 2018 10:33:31 -0500 - rev 460432
Push 8942 by ryanvm@gmail.com at Thu, 29 Mar 2018 14:09:55 +0000
Bug 1447796 - Fix closing page action panels using commands. r=rpl, a=jcristau If commands are used with the page action panel, they will toggle open or closed. We need to keep a handle on our custom panel so we can close it. MozReview-Commit-ID: JfxwlyK8g8g
0e8ea2c1220a: Bug 1447345 - Change enterprise policy that sets homepage to set it as the default rather than the user value for the pref. r=Felipe, a=jcristau
Kirk Steuber <ksteuber@mozilla.com> - Tue, 20 Mar 2018 10:43:19 -0700 - rev 460431
Push 8942 by ryanvm@gmail.com at Thu, 29 Mar 2018 14:09:55 +0000
Bug 1447345 - Change enterprise policy that sets homepage to set it as the default rather than the user value for the pref. r=Felipe, a=jcristau Additionally removes a stray debugging line that I accidentally checked into the tree previously. MozReview-Commit-ID: 7F2S8WBgKCj
50c2162dfe7f: Bug 1449499 - Fix fullscreen_window.py:test_handle_prompt_missing_value for wrong dialog reference. r=ato, a=test-only
Henrik Skupin <mail@hskupin.info> - Wed, 28 Mar 2018 11:13:21 +0200 - rev 460430
Push 8942 by ryanvm@gmail.com at Thu, 29 Mar 2018 14:09:55 +0000
Bug 1449499 - Fix fullscreen_window.py:test_handle_prompt_missing_value for wrong dialog reference. r=ato, a=test-only MozReview-Commit-ID: GhQzudT6D1u
bfe7012b7d58: Bug 1448136 - Ensure Debug OSR transition is respected in InstanceOf Fallback stub. r=jandem, a=RyanVM
Matthew Gaudet <mgaudet@mozilla.com> - Fri, 23 Mar 2018 13:10:08 -0700 - rev 460429
Push 8941 by ryanvm@gmail.com at Wed, 28 Mar 2018 19:57:26 +0000
Bug 1448136 - Ensure Debug OSR transition is respected in InstanceOf Fallback stub. r=jandem, a=RyanVM
17a3b84a2ac3: Bug 1444086 - TlsScope should use WeakPtr. r=jrmuizel, a=RyanVM
Jeff Gilbert <jgilbert@mozilla.com> - Tue, 27 Mar 2018 12:29:19 -0400 - rev 460428
Push 8941 by ryanvm@gmail.com at Wed, 28 Mar 2018 19:57:26 +0000
Bug 1444086 - TlsScope should use WeakPtr. r=jrmuizel, a=RyanVM MozReview-Commit-ID: DX99PqmxMpF
16307dd2fdf1: Bug 1443092 - Avoid calling SVGAnimatedEnumeration::AnimVal() from nsSVGUtils::GetBBox(). r=jwatt, a=RyanVM
Botond Ballo <botond@mozilla.com> - Fri, 09 Mar 2018 17:26:24 -0500 - rev 460427
Push 8941 by ryanvm@gmail.com at Wed, 28 Mar 2018 19:57:26 +0000
Bug 1443092 - Avoid calling SVGAnimatedEnumeration::AnimVal() from nsSVGUtils::GetBBox(). r=jwatt, a=RyanVM AnimVal() is a DOM getter, and it flushes animations, which we don't want in GetBBox() which is called from display list building cide and FrameLayerBuilder. MozReview-Commit-ID: 80DyTcGs5io
e724c32284b2: Bug 1409440. r=tnikkel, a=RyanVM
Andrew Osmond <aosmond@mozilla.com> - Tue, 27 Mar 2018 09:01:14 -0400 - rev 460426
Push 8941 by ryanvm@gmail.com at Wed, 28 Mar 2018 19:57:26 +0000
Bug 1409440. r=tnikkel, a=RyanVM
a125dbf21643: Bug 1447821 - Add logging to ADTSSampleConverter ctor. r=jya, a=jcristau
Bryce Van Dyk <bvandyk@mozilla.com> - Mon, 26 Mar 2018 14:29:31 -0400 - rev 460425
Push 8940 by ryanvm@gmail.com at Wed, 28 Mar 2018 19:11:14 +0000
Bug 1447821 - Add logging to ADTSSampleConverter ctor. r=jya, a=jcristau Add logging to aid in debugging of our EME ADTS conversion path. MozReview-Commit-ID: A7Wv8n31V8V
0db4e4e9ce11: Bug 1447821 - Update EMEDecoderModule to handle profile values < 1. r=jya, a=jcristau
Bryce Van Dyk <bvandyk@mozilla.com> - Fri, 23 Mar 2018 14:54:41 -0400 - rev 460424
Push 8940 by ryanvm@gmail.com at Wed, 28 Mar 2018 19:11:14 +0000
Bug 1447821 - Update EMEDecoderModule to handle profile values < 1. r=jya, a=jcristau Update EMEDecoderModule to use 2 as profile number when the given profile is less than 1 or greater than 4. The CDM doesn't appear to care what values are given, but 2 was chosen as a safe fallback per discussion on the bug. This addresses the use case where 0 values are stored in mProfile due to the use of extended profiles (which are then stored in the mExtendedProfile field). MozReview-Commit-ID: 5XgabNDsgdf
1a6f6fdaa772: Bug 1433037 - WindowsPreviewPerTab should use decodeImageAsync. r=aosmond, a=RyanVM
Andrea Marchesini <amarchesini@mozilla.com> - Mon, 26 Mar 2018 17:59:11 +0200 - rev 460423
Push 8940 by ryanvm@gmail.com at Wed, 28 Mar 2018 19:11:14 +0000
Bug 1433037 - WindowsPreviewPerTab should use decodeImageAsync. r=aosmond, a=RyanVM
(0) -300000 -100000 -30000 -10000 -3000 -1000 -300 -100 -50 -20 +20 +50 +100 +300 +1000 +3000 +10000 +30000 tip